如何构建不链接到Musl libc的go可执行文件

时间:2019-02-04 21:46:28

标签: docker go alpine

所以:

官方的Go构建容器基于Alpine。

Alpine使用musl作为libc而不是glibc。

我需要在可以使用glibc的Ubuntu上运行的容器中构建Go可执行文件。

我该怎么办

  1. 使正式的GoLang构建容器使用glibc或
  2. 在基于Ubuntu的容器上构建我的GoLang项目

我无法使用Disable CGO解决方案,因为我的Go代码是FUSE驱动程序,需要CGO

0 个答案:

没有答案